Form 4: Lilly Endowment Reduces Eli Lilly Stake
Insider Transaction Report
Lilly Endowment Inc., a 10% owner of Eli Lilly & Co., reported the sale of 301,342 common shares for approximately $260.7 million on October 31, 2025.
Summary
- Lilly Endowment Inc., identified as a 10% owner of Eli Lilly & Co. (LLY), reported multiple sales of common stock.
- A total of 301,342 shares were disposed of on October 31, 2025.
- The sales occurred at weighted average prices ranging from $862.631 to $869.466 per share.
- The estimated total value of the shares sold is approximately $260.7 million.
- Following these transactions, Lilly Endowment Inc. beneficially owns 94,231,978 shares of Eli Lilly & Co. common stock, down from an initial 94,533,320 shares before these reported sales.
